// Example for drawSmoothArc function. // Draws smooth arcs with rounded or square smooth ends #include // Include the graphics library TFT_eSPI tft = TFT_eSPI(); // Create object "tft" // ------------------------------------------------------------------------- // Setup // ------------------------------------------------------------------------- void setup(void) { Serial.begin(115200); tft.init(); tft.setRotation(1); tft.fillScreen(TFT_BLACK); } // ------------------------------------------------------------------------- // Main loop // ------------------------------------------------------------------------- void loop() { static uint32_t count = 0; uint16_t fg_color = random(0x10000); uint16_t bg_color = TFT_BLACK; // This is the background colour used for smoothing (anti-aliasing) uint16_t x = random(tft.width()); // Position of centre of arc uint16_t y = random(tft.height()); uint8_t radius = random(20, tft.width()/4); // Outer arc radius uint8_t thickness = random(1, radius / 4); // Thickness uint8_t inner_radius = radius - thickness; // Calculate inner radius (can be 0 for circle segment) // 0 degrees is at 6 o'clock position // Arcs are drawn clockwise from start_angle to end_angle uint16_t start_angle = random(361); // Start angle must be in range 0 to 360 uint16_t end_angle = random(361); // End angle must be in range 0 to 360 bool arc_end = random(2); // true = round ends, false = square ends (arc_end parameter can be omitted, ends will then be square) tft.drawSmoothArc(x, y, radius, inner_radius, start_angle, end_angle, fg_color, bg_color, arc_end); count++; if (count < 30) delay(500); // After 15s draw as fast as possible! }
